    At its simplest, water treatment refers to any method used to improve the quality of water. This can mean removing visible particles, eliminating harmful microbes, reducing hardness, adjusting pH, or stripping out dissolved contaminants. The exact water treatment process depends on the source of the water and the end use. For example, drinking water treatment focuses on safety, taste, and compliance with health standards, while process water treatment in industrial settings may prioritize preventing corrosion, scaling, fouling, or interference with production. In either case, the goal is to transform raw water into water that meets a defined standard. That standard may be set by public health regulators, product requirements, environmental rules, or internal performance goals.

    The water treatment process often begins with screening and preliminary removal of large debris. Water taken from rivers, reservoirs, wells, or municipal sources may carry sticks, leaves, grit, and other materials that must be removed early to protect downstream equipment. After this initial stage, many systems move into coagulation and flocculation, where chemicals are added to destabilize tiny suspended particles so they can clump together. These larger clumps, called flocs, are easier to separate from the water through sedimentation or filtration. This step is essential because very small particles often remain suspended for long periods and can make water cloudy or difficult to disinfect. In many facilities, this physical and chemical combination is a core part of the overall water treatment process.

    Filtration is another fundamental part of water treatment. It helps remove suspended solids, bacteria, and other impurities depending on the filter type. Sand filters, multimedia filters, cartridge filters, and membrane systems each have different strengths and are selected based on water quality goals. In municipal drinking water treatment, filtration often follows coagulation and sedimentation to further polish the water before disinfection. In process water treatment, filtration may be used to protect boilers, cooling towers, production equipment, or sensitive manufacturing systems. If particles are not removed, they can clog pipes, damage pumps, reduce heat transfer efficiency, or interfere with product consistency. This is why filtration remains one of the most widely used and versatile tools in the water treatment process.

    Disinfection is a critical final barrier in many water treatment systems. Even if water looks clear, it may still contain bacteria, viruses, or other pathogens that can cause illness. Chlorine, chloramine, ozone, ultraviolet light, and other methods are commonly used to reduce or eliminate these risks. Each method has advantages and limitations. Chlorine is widely used because it is effective and leaves a residual disinfectant in the distribution system, but it may create byproducts if water contains certain organic compounds. Ultraviolet treatment can inactivate many microorganisms without adding chemicals, but it provides no lasting residual protection. Ozone is powerful and efficient, yet it requires careful handling and system design. The best disinfection method depends on the purpose of the water and the overall water treatment process in place.

    In process water treatment, the requirements are often more specialized than in municipal drinking water systems. Many industries rely on water that must be extremely consistent in quality. A food and beverage plant may need purified water to preserve taste and product safety. A pharmaceutical facility may require highly controlled water that meets strict purity standards. A power plant may need treated water to prevent scale formation and corrosion in boilers and cooling systems. A semiconductor manufacturer may require ultra-pure water to avoid microscopic contamination that can ruin delicate components. In each of these cases, the water treatment process is designed not only to remove impurities, but also to create water with specific chemical and physical characteristics that support operational performance.

    Hardness removal is one of the most common concerns in process water treatment. Hard water contains calcium and magnesium ions that can form scale on pipes, heating elements, and membranes. Scale can reduce efficiency, increase energy consumption, and lead to costly repairs or downtime. Water softening, usually through ion exchange, replaces hardness ions with sodium or other ions that do not form scale as easily. In more advanced applications, reverse osmosis and demineralization may be used to remove a broad range of dissolved salts and minerals. These processes are especially important when water is being used in boilers, cooling systems, or sensitive production environments where mineral buildup could create major operational problems. By controlling hardness and dissolved solids, the water treatment process helps facilities run more reliably and efficiently.

    Another important aspect of water treatment is controlling pH. Water that is too acidic or too alkaline can damage equipment, affect chemical reactions, or reduce treatment effectiveness. For example, acidic water may corrode metal pipes and fixtures, while water with a high pH can contribute to scaling and reduce the performance of certain disinfectants. Adjusting pH is often a balancing act that depends on water source chemistry, treatment objectives, and distribution conditions. In process water treatment, pH control is especially important because industrial systems often involve metals, membranes, chemicals, and process steps that are sensitive to even small fluctuations. A properly managed pH level can protect infrastructure and improve the stability of the overall water treatment process.

    Membrane technologies have become increasingly important in modern water treatment. Reverse osmosis, nanofiltration, ultrafiltration, and microfiltration are all used to separate contaminants based on size and chemical properties. These systems can remove fine particles, microbes, and dissolved substances with a high degree of precision. Reverse osmosis is especially valuable when extremely low levels of dissolved solids are required, though it produces a concentrate stream that must be managed. Membrane systems are widely used in process water treatment because they can produce consistent water quality for demanding applications. They are also becoming more common in municipal and commercial systems as water scarcity, regulation, and quality demands increase. The flexibility of membrane-based water treatment makes it an important part of current and future water management strategies.

    Water treatment also involves ongoing monitoring and maintenance. A system is only effective if it is properly operated and regularly checked. Operators may measure turbidity, pH, chlorine residual, conductivity, hardness, microbial activity, and other indicators depending on the treatment goals. Filters need replacement or backwashing, chemical feeds must be calibrated, membranes cleaned, and tanks or lines inspected for buildup or contamination. This continuous attention is what keeps the water treatment process dependable over time. In process water treatment, monitoring is especially important because a small shift in water quality can affect product quality, equipment life, and regulatory compliance. Preventive maintenance and data-driven control systems are now widely used to improve consistency and reduce risk.

    A corrugated box maker plays a central function in contemporary product packaging because it changes easy resources right into long lasting, sensible, and highly personalized containers made use of throughout countless markets. Whether a business is shipping fragile electronics, heavy industrial parts, retail items, or fresh fruit and vegetables, the quality of package can have a direct influence on product security, transportation effectiveness, and brand name discussion. A cardboard box maker is commonly chosen for its capability to create product packaging that is lightweight yet solid, cost-effective yet expert, and versatile adequate to meet the demands of both large-scale makers and smaller sized businesses. As ecommerce remains to broaden and worldwide supply chains come to be more requiring, the value of trusted box production has actually just expanded, making box making modern technology an essential component of product packaging procedures around the globe.

    When individuals look for a box machine or box making machine, they are often seeking tools that can boost performance while minimizing manual labor and disparity. In conventional packaging atmospheres, boxes were usually reduced, folded up, and set up by hand, which called for time, initiative, and a huge workforce. Today, automated and semi-automated makers have actually changed that procedure significantly. A modern-day box maker machine can manage tasks such as reducing corrugated sheets, racking up fold lines, slotting panels, gluing flaps, and also printing branding info. This degree of automation enables businesses to generate boxes promptly and accurately, ensuring that each ended up carton fulfills the exact same requirements. The outcome is less waste, less mistakes, and an extra reliable packaging line generally.

    Because corrugated product packaging uses a superb balance of strength and convenience, the corrugated box maker is specifically valued. Corrugated board is built making use of layers that offer padding and architectural assistance, that makes it ideal for whatever from shipping fragile products to saving mass items. A cardboard box maker that deals with corrugated board can create single-wall, double-wall, or even triple-wall boxes depending upon the required toughness. This flexibility is one factor corrugated product packaging has ended up being such a leading option in logistics and retail. Companies can choose the best board grade and style based on product weight, dealing with problems, and delivery distance, while the machine ensures those specs are adhered to with accuracy.

    When a design is ended up, the board enters pcb fabrication. This is the manufacturing process that creates the bare printed circuit card before components are added. Pcb fabrication manufacturers and pcb manufacturers shape the board from materials such as FR4, Rogers laminates, polyimide, aluminum, ceramic pcb materials, or metal core pcb material depending on the application. FR4 is typical since it is affordable, secure, and commonly readily available, however high frequency pcb and hdi pcb layouts might call for specialized materials with controlled dielectric properties. Throughout pcb fabrication, layers of copper are laminated to shielding material, holes are drilled or lasered, vias are produced, and surface areas are do with options such as HASL or ENIG. When individuals ask “how are motherboard made” or “what are pcb boards made from,” the solution is a split combination of insulating substrate, copper traces, and safety surface coatings.

    Pcb assembly is the following significant step, where components are installed onto the produced board. In functional terms, pcba vs pcb is simple: the pcb is the bare board, while the pcba is the ended up board with components installed. Pcb assembly manufacturers, electronics contract manufacturers, and turnkey pcb assembly suppliers may take care of the entire process from fabrication via testing and product packaging.
